By adding Jon Gruden, Filip Kral, and Jack St. Ivany to their roster, the Penguins have made calculated moves to bolster their team's depth and future contributors.

Jack St. Ivany plays the important function of bottom pairing.

After Chad Ruhwedel was traded late in the season, Jack St. Ivany became an important contributor. St. Ivany, who entered the bottom pairing on the right, performed admirably, finishing with a 51.53 xGF% in 160 minutes. The Penguins made a wise decision in signing him since there isn't much danger involved. If all goes wrong, St. Ivany will go back to WB/S. His three-year contract at the league minimum presents an opportunity to be a reliable bottom pairing defenseman at a lower cost than recent overpayments for comparable roles such as Jan Rutta.

Jon Gruden offers a dependable depth forward choice.

In addition, the Penguins signed depth forward Jon Gruden to a contract that was one year shorter than St. Ivany's. Though there are differing views on this deal, Gruden is anticipated to be a dependable call-up option in case of several injuries. Because of him, younger players at WB/S may get a lot of playing time without constantly being called up and demoted. Gruden will probably only be a stopgap, switching back and forth between Pittsburgh and WB/S as required.

From SM-Liiga, Filip Kral adds attacking potential.

Filip Kral, a former member of the Toronto Maple Leafs organization, is the third addition. In 46 games as a defenseman in the SM-Liiga last season, Kral demonstrated his attacking prowess. This accomplishment is equivalent to an anticipated 30 points over the course of an 82-game NHL season, according to NHLe. Kral's signing, however little known, may provide the Penguins' defense much-needed offensive depth.
All things considered, these acquisitions are sensible, low-risk choices that provide the Penguins' roster much-needed depth. Without making large financial commitments, each player has the ability to boost the team's roster in a variety of ways.
